Exophase Review - Might and Magic: Clash of Heroes: A Fresh Take On The Strategy Genre

While the bulk of portable offerings tend to mimic their console brethren in bite-sized form, a select few dare to separate themselves from what is considered traditional for a genre. It's hardly surprising, given that taking risks from a creative standpoint can be an unsettling venture at times. When risks are taken and executed properly, however, it pays off in spades. Ubisoft's DS title Might and Magic: Clash of Heroes strongly exemplifies this notion, offering a fresh, titillating take on the turn-based RPG genre. (Might & Magic: Clash of Heroes, Nintendo DS) 5/5
